ABT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

2,015 of the 4,605 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Abbott (ABT)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$111B — up 5.8% from $105B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 109 funds opened new ABT positions and 72 closed out — a net gain of 37 holders — while 743 added to existing stakes and 859 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ital International Investors, adding an estimated $1.07B.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$230M.
